Frequently Asked Questions About Pest Control in Wellman

Get answers to common questions about pest control services in Wellman, Iowa.

1What are the most common pest problems for homeowners in Wellman, and when should I be most concerned about them?

In Wellman, the most prevalent pests include mice and voles seeking warmth in fall/winter, ants (especially carpenter and pavement ants) in spring/summer, and occasional issues with wasps, boxelder bugs, and cluster flies. Due to Iowa's distinct seasons, spring and fall are critical times for preventative treatments, as pests actively seek entry into homes during these temperature shifts. Local agricultural activity can also influence field mouse and insect pressures.

2How much should I expect to pay for pest control services in the Wellman area?

Costs vary based on service type; a one-time treatment for a common issue like ants typically ranges from $125 to $300. For comprehensive annual plans covering seasonal pests common to Iowa, expect quarterly visits to cost between $400 and $700 per year. Pricing is influenced by your home's size, infestation severity, and the specific pests targeted, with rodent control often priced separately.

3Are there any local Iowa or Wellman regulations I should know about when hiring a pest control company?

Yes, always verify that the company is licensed by the Iowa Department of Agriculture and Land Stewardship (IDALS) Pesticide Bureau. This ensures they meet state standards for safe and legal application. Reputable Wellman providers will also be familiar with local ordinances and will follow Iowa's regulations regarding pesticide use near sensitive areas, which is especially important in residential neighborhoods.

4What should I look for when choosing a pest control provider in Wellman?

Prioritize local companies with strong community reputations, as they understand Wellman's specific pest patterns. Ensure they are IDALS-licensed, insured, and offer clear service guarantees. Ask about their experience with Iowa's common pests and if they provide integrated pest management (IPM) strategies, which focus on long-term prevention with the least possible hazard to people and the local environment.

5Is DIY pest control effective, or should I always call a professional in Wellman?

For minor, isolated issues, DIY can offer temporary relief. However, for recurring infestations or structural pests like carpenter ants, termites, or mice, professional service is crucial. Professionals have access to more effective materials and the expertise to find and treat the root cause, which is often hidden. Given Iowa's climate-driven pest cycles, a pro can implement a preventative schedule that DIY methods typically cannot sustain.
